    A Notary or Notary Signing Agent is someone who represents the State and the community in protecting many legal aspects through verifying an identity of an individual signing a document and witnessing them siging the document. When you request the services of a Notary be prepared to be present and provide a valid ID such as Drivers license or State issued picture ID. In some cases you may be asked to privide a second form of ID, i.e. signed social security card in order to match the signatures. Take in to account that a Notary cannot prepare any document for you or advise what type of Notary act is needed, you need to tell the Notary what it is you need and do not sign the document until you are infront on the Notary.
